diff --git a/src/apps/schema-generator/util/generate.ts b/src/apps/schema-generator/util/generate.ts index 6fd7cbfb96555c0c2995b3e0f61252abc7e58c73..38346cc662b3b8f7df444ab3abf8845cbcbefec0 100644 --- a/src/apps/schema-generator/util/generate.ts +++ b/src/apps/schema-generator/util/generate.ts @@ -34,7 +34,7 @@ const List = Schema.List;` function footer (name: string) { return ` export type ${name}_Schema = typeof ${name}_Schema; -export interface ${name}_Database extends Database<${name}_Schema> { }` +export type ${name}_Database = Database<${name}_Schema>` } const value: { [k: string]: (...args: any[]) => string } = { diff --git a/src/mol-io/reader/cif/schema/bird.ts b/src/mol-io/reader/cif/schema/bird.ts index 80329868d023d523388c1da16075b0c4d1adcb7b..c30af8433d4c9552da813f0c3cf27e9606d0b692 100644 --- a/src/mol-io/reader/cif/schema/bird.ts +++ b/src/mol-io/reader/cif/schema/bird.ts @@ -122,4 +122,4 @@ export const BIRD_Schema = { } export type BIRD_Schema = typeof BIRD_Schema; -export interface BIRD_Database extends Database<BIRD_Schema> { } \ No newline at end of file +export type BIRD_Database = Database<BIRD_Schema> \ No newline at end of file diff --git a/src/mol-io/reader/cif/schema/ccd.ts b/src/mol-io/reader/cif/schema/ccd.ts index 208353c5e617d784b815784c3901339bca248465..b4c3d0bf8105de73b5c9245fbbfeb1df9e9e88c9 100644 --- a/src/mol-io/reader/cif/schema/ccd.ts +++ b/src/mol-io/reader/cif/schema/ccd.ts @@ -89,4 +89,4 @@ export const CCD_Schema = { } export type CCD_Schema = typeof CCD_Schema; -export interface CCD_Database extends Database<CCD_Schema> { } \ No newline at end of file +export type CCD_Database = Database<CCD_Schema> \ No newline at end of file diff --git a/src/mol-io/reader/cif/schema/dic.ts b/src/mol-io/reader/cif/schema/dic.ts index 07db825731e9860df7fa088af4d643128745abb8..64cd310a5dabd2a207f9c622a92fb10fcaa00520 100644 --- a/src/mol-io/reader/cif/schema/dic.ts +++ b/src/mol-io/reader/cif/schema/dic.ts @@ -72,4 +72,4 @@ export const CIFDictionary_Schema = { } export type CIFDictionary_Schema = typeof CIFDictionary_Schema; -export interface CIFDictionary_Database extends Database.Tables<CIFDictionary_Schema> { } \ No newline at end of file +export type CIFDictionary_Database = Database.Tables<CIFDictionary_Schema> \ No newline at end of file diff --git a/src/mol-io/reader/cif/schema/mmcif.ts b/src/mol-io/reader/cif/schema/mmcif.ts index a09cbe6520d504a153dfd1c48ddf4c2639c44224..2632ae26f0672ff3f47d4a162b0fc585b1826e53 100644 --- a/src/mol-io/reader/cif/schema/mmcif.ts +++ b/src/mol-io/reader/cif/schema/mmcif.ts @@ -222,4 +222,4 @@ export const mmCIF_Schema = { } export type mmCIF_Schema = typeof mmCIF_Schema; -export interface mmCIF_Database extends Database<mmCIF_Schema> { } \ No newline at end of file +export type mmCIF_Database = Database<mmCIF_Schema> \ No newline at end of file